Transaction edb6953589c8e62734ccb123a996c3aca90b444b4cd865a2e759cbeaca518fcc

64 Input
2 Outputs
  • edb6953589c8e62734ccb123a996c3aca90b444b4cd865a2e759cbeaca518fcc:0
  • value  600000000
    address  3MForezcpZXK28xDCXqoxEX64uCPhHu5qk
  • edb6953589c8e62734ccb123a996c3aca90b444b4cd865a2e759cbeaca518fcc:1
  • value  8706219
    address  1D8A2Q4R1kwHRefJVTu529ZaWGxB1gwmmx